Tried to Install Solaris 10 on a Laptop (got given this Laptop install CD at the JavaUK 06 gig). First tried it on a old Toshiba Satellite Laptop. Preped it with Partation magic to make a 12G partation. It wouldnt install. Do went into Partation magic and set up Partation ID manually. Solaris 10 wont install over a Linux partation. You need to set the partation ID to 0xbf. Then everything installs sweet.

The Java Desktop looks way better than windows XP and reminds me of the BSD based OS that Mac people love. Everything stable, firefox comes standard on the install. sweet. No Internet? Hmm... No CARDBUS drivers. So my old Xircom card wont work.

Next I try on a more upto date Toshiba Tecra Laptop, built in Nvidia graphics, WiFi and Ethernet. Installs first time, no fuss, no muss. Everything works. Even WiFi. Quick check, it works brill!
